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Базы";
Текущий архив: 2005.02.27;
Скачать: [xml.tar.bz2];

Вниз

Репликация в InterBase   Найти похожие ветки 

 
cherrex ©   (2005-01-21 23:02) [0]

Помогите разобраться с репликациями в InterBase. Не могу понять как работает InterBase Replication Manager. У меня есть две базы, в них одинаковые по структуре таблицы, при изменения даннах в одной таблицы, данные меняются в другой. По моему это зеркальная репликация или зеркалирование. Заранее Благодарен!!!


 
Johnmen ©   (2005-01-22 02:29) [1]

Вопрос то в чем ?
И не надо путать репликацию с "зеркалированием".


 
cherrex ©   (2005-01-22 10:31) [2]

А как и с помощью чего можно реализовать зеркалирование в InterBase, если не с помощью репликации.


 
DrPass ©   (2005-01-22 13:47) [3]

Создать теневую копию БД


 
Alexandr ©   (2005-01-24 07:17) [4]

ненадо путать теневую копию, репликацию, зеркалирование и прочее.
давайте сначала спросим у вопрошающего, чего ему надо.


 
cherrex ©   (2005-01-24 14:55) [5]

Мне надо: 1)создать две базы, географически распределенные и разные по структуре, но в обеих базах есть две одинаковые по структуре таблицы.
         2)произвести синхронизацию двух таблиц, то есть при вводе, изменении и удалении записей в одной таблицы тоже самое происходит в другой и на оборот.

В итоге данные в этих таблицах полностью одинаковые.


 
cherrex ©   (2005-01-24 14:56) [6]

Мне надо: 1)создать две базы, географически распределенные и разные по структуре, но в обеих базах есть две одинаковые по структуре таблицы.
         2)произвести синхронизацию двух таблиц, то есть при вводе, изменении и удалении записей в одной таблицы тоже самое происходит в другой и на оборот.

В итоге данные в этих таблицах полностью одинаковые.


 
msguns ©   (2005-01-24 15:06) [7]

Эти таблицы (таблица) что-то вроде справочника ?


 
cherrex ©   (2005-01-24 15:11) [8]

ДА правильно это и есть справочники.


 
msguns ©   (2005-01-24 15:25) [9]

>cherrex ©   (24.01.05 15:11) [8]
>ДА правильно это и есть справочники.

Тогда вот это:

произвести синхронизацию двух таблиц, то есть при вводе, изменении и удалении записей в одной таблицы тоже самое происходит в другой и на оборот.

есть мина весьма большой разрушительно силы


 
cherrex ©   (2005-01-24 17:45) [10]

А по понятней?


 
bSava ©   (2005-01-24 21:56) [11]

Что значит: создать две базы, географически распределенные и разные по структуре, но в обеих базах есть две одинаковые по структуре таблицы. Насколько они физически разнесены? И как между ними осуществляется связь? Может стоит создать третью базу и хранить там только справочники, а при необходимости уже с ней проводить сравнение?


 
Alexandr ©   (2005-01-27 15:57) [12]

ужись...
ну подумай, нарисую на бумажке как вот это должно быть
"произвести синхронизацию двух таблиц, то есть при вводе, изменении и удалении записей в одной таблицы тоже самое происходит в другой и на оборот.
"
н забыв рассмотреть варианты:
1) в одном филиале редактирут,  вдругом удаляют.
2) редактируют одну и ту же запись в обоих филиалах
3) вставляют одну и ту же запись в обоих филиалах.
4) формат файла синхронизации.
5) обновление ушло, но не дошло до получателя
6) обновление дошло, но была ошибка ввода изменений

и т.д.


 
Domkrat ©   (2005-01-27 16:19) [13]

Если канал связи позволяет делать задуманное при вводе информации, так может стои пользоваться одной для всех базой данных?


 
msguns ©   (2005-01-27 16:32) [14]

При схеме объединения частных баз в кумулятивную методом репликации должно выполняться несколько важных условий.
Приведу лишь основные:

1. Глобальные справочники не могут корректиться в филиалах либо изменения к ним (точнее, пополнения) идут отдельным пакетом и реплицируются на сервере по спец.алгоритмам.
2. Рассылаемые в филиалы БД должны иметь доп.глобальный реквизит - ID филиала во всех главных таблицах. Именно он служит основным "разрулирующим" механизме при репликации данного типа. В противном случае алгоритм репликации будет на два порядка сложнее, вплоть для создания специальной дополнительной базы для предварительного "слива" всей пришедшей с филиалов инфы и разборок с нею. (В частности, разборок с реидентификацией)



Страницы: 1 вся ветка

Форум: "Базы";
Текущий архив: 2005.02.27;
Скачать: [xml.tar.bz2];

Наверх




Память: 0.48 MB
Время: 0.039 c
3-1106647034
paule
2005-01-25 12:57
2005.02.27
Ошибка при записи


14-1107444236
Almaz
2005-02-03 18:23
2005.02.27
Чего только не узнаешь :)


3-1107182429
MakedoneZ
2005-01-31 17:40
2005.02.27
Почему появляется ошибка "Dataset not in edit or inser mode"


1-1108321496
Вовик
2005-02-13 22:04
2005.02.27
Как мне узнать над каким объектом выскочило PopupMenu?


14-1107348310
saNat
2005-02-02 15:45
2005.02.27
Автоматизация





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ский